Check that a single URI/property parameter (not a property path) is valid, and expand it if required @ignore
protected function checkSinglePropertyParam(&$property, &$inverse) {
if (is_object($property) and $property instanceof EasyRdf_Resource) {
$property = $property
->getUri();
}
elseif (is_object($property) and $property instanceof EasyRdf_ParsedUri) {
$property = strval($property);
}
elseif (is_string($property)) {
if ($property == '') {
throw new InvalidArgumentException("\$property cannot be an empty string");
}
elseif (substr($property, 0, 1) == '^') {
$inverse = true;
$property = EasyRdf_Namespace::expand(substr($property, 1));
}
elseif (substr($property, 0, 2) == '_:') {
throw new InvalidArgumentException("\$property cannot be a blank node");
}
else {
$inverse = false;
$property = EasyRdf_Namespace::expand($property);
}
}
if ($property === null or !is_string($property)) {
throw new InvalidArgumentException("\$property should be a string or EasyRdf_Resource and cannot be null");
}
}
